Summary
One of two oak cupboards fitted onto piers between the windows. There are three shelf sections; the two upper sections both wide cornices, and two shelves. The lower section also has a wide cornice, with five shelves. They have a grained wood surface. The shelves stand on a slab of black marble with a fall-front oak cupboard below. The cupboard is fitted with two pairs of sliding shelves, each divided into three compartments. A wider black marble slab is below it, on a two-door cupboard. The cupboards are oak, with a solid oak base. The cupboard doors are of carved latticed brass wire with a pleated red silk backing. A carved colonette stands each side with carved leaves top and bottom and a section of reeding in the centre.
